PLEDGE AND ACCOUNTABILITY TRACKER​

Accountability is the bedrock of climate justice

Our flagship “Pledge and Accountability Tracker” will provide a comprehensive dashboard designed to ensure transparency at every stage of the delivery of support by the Fund for Responding to Loss and Damage (FRLD).

First, we will track the money flowing into the fund, monitoring pledges, analysing their quality (are they grants or repackaged loans or aid?), and verifying their conversion into real and accessible debt free money.

Second, we follow the money to the ground level. Monitor how these resources are disbursed and used within countries, looking closely at whether the process centres community needs and promotes local leadership.

By illuminating this entire journey, the Tracker intends to make every actor in the process accountable, from the contributor to the implementing agency, to guarantee that the funds deliver real, community-led solutions.

CURRENT FUNDING STATUS

Transparency means knowing exactly where the money is. Below is the current status of the resources directed toward the FRLD:

FUNDING STAGE

Amount pledged to the FRLD
(promised to be paid.)

CURRENT AMOUNT

821.74 million USD

DATA SOURCE

FRLD website

NOTES & CONTEXT

At every Board meeting, a "status of resources" document is provided. This tracks which countries pledged, and whether they have paid their contributions yet.

FUNDING STAGE

Agreements signed
(Contribution agreements).

CURRENT AMOUNT

613.64 million USD

DATA SOURCE

World Bank FIF webpage

NOTES & CONTEXT

The World Bank serves as the host for the FRLD’s trust fund (essentially the bank account where this money is held).

FUNDING STAGE

Funds held (Paid into the trusts fund).

CURRENT AMOUNT

457.57 million USD

DATA SOURCE

World Bank FIF webpage

NOTES & CONTEXT

This represents the actual, real cash currently sitting in the account and ready to be utilized.
